Store lyophilized/reconstituted at -20°C; once reconstituted make aliquots to avoid repeated freeze-thaw cycles. Please remember to spin the tubes briefly prior to opening them to avoid any losses that might occur from material adhering to the cap or sides of the tube.
For reconstitution add 50 µL of sterile water.

HDA6 encodes a RPD3-type (class I) histone deacetylase in Arabidopsis thaliana that is predominantly nuclear and is enriched in discrete nuclear subdomains including the nucleolus, consistent with roles in rDNA-associated chromatin regulation. The encoded protein is a ~471 amino-acid enzyme containing a conserved histone deacetylase catalytic domain typical of RPD3/HDAC family members, enabling removal of acetyl groups from lysine residues on histone H3/H4 tails and thereby promoting chromatin compaction. Functionally, HDA6 acts as a key epigenetic repressor that helps maintain transcriptional silencing of repetitive loci, including rDNA repeats and transposable elements, with loss of HDA6 leading to localized histone hyperacetylation, altered histone methylation patterns, chromatin decondensation, and transcriptional derepression. Mechanistically, HDA6 cooperates with DNA methylation pathways, including direct interaction with the maintenance CG methyltransferase MET1, linking histone deacetylation to the establishment/maintenance of heterochromatic DNA methylation states and stable genome-wide repression of silenced loci.
